For the verbal description of a function, write a formula for f.Function f multiplies the input x by 3 and then subtracts 4 from the result to obtain the output y.
A. f(x) = 4x + 3
B. f(x) = 3x + 4
C. f(x) = 3x - 4
D. f(x) = 4x - 3
Answer: C
